How they compare
Latvia currently reports 15.8% against 14.8% in Italy, a difference of 1.0%.
That makes Latvia's figure about 1.1 times Italy's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 15 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Italy ahead.
Italy ranks 16th and Latvia ranks 15th of 73 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Italy | Latvia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 18.6% | 6.8% | 11.7% | Italy |
| 2010s | 16.7% | 10.5% | 6.2% | Italy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
